How do I look at the send from address?

Thanks for the help guys, this is quite frustrating. Not sure what the deal is.

Both Bittrex and my wallet show 0/Confirmations.

UPDATE: If I rescan the wallet, the 5000 shows back up. However, as soon as I try to send it anyway, I get a conflict and it gets removed again... saying that its already been spent?

The send addresses will be your main receive address. It usually goes last in first out. It sounds like you may need to purge the appdata solarcoin directory, everything except your wallet file. Make sure you make a few backups of your wallet, then delete the files except your wallet file in the %appdata%/solarcoin folder. Reload the blockchain, hopefully this should fix the problem.

There is no way that livecoin overtook bittrex. They know how to fake volume thats for sure..

Why do you feel that Livecoin is a untrustworthy exchange.
It smells from here ...
- too large volume for a new exchange, looks like fake volume.
- even with an address in the UK ...a lot to see with russia
- low quality web interface
- when you click on "contact us", this is not a text, but an image, why ? they have to hide something ? they don't like search engine.
- when you click on "about us" , you are supposed to find all the relative information of the site , with the name of the CEO, and all people involved on the site ...there is just some blah blah blah .
- http://www.endole.co.uk/company/08146865/delta-e-commerce-ltd , only one person , with such huge volume , how is it possible ?
- Already been suspect by the past , we are not alone to have doubts, https://www.dash.org/forum/threads/2-2-million-volume-today-over-1-5-million-on-livecoin.7663/

To be fair all of what you stated is the exact reason why I don't trust Poloinex at this point.  You really have not information on who is controlling the exchange

Hey is anyone else having a problem with there wallet balance being wrong?

I checked my wallet on the SolarCoin Blockchain Explorer and everything is correct. But my online wallet is showing more coins then i have. I believe i need to just re scan because this happened one time before but when i tried to re scan it took over 1 hour and i finally gave up. My interest is working find so i might just leave it alone.

I also have 39 connections instead of my usual 9  Huh



It's okay to have more connections. It means more wallets are connecting through your firewall. I typically have near 40 connections on one of my wallets that I have the ports forwarded to.

The blockchain isn't going to be 100% accurate from your wallet because your wallet hides coins in different addresses. If the wallet is in synch and everything is working okay then you're fine.
